Art insurance brokers are specialists who work with collectors, galleries, museums, and other art owners to provide tailored insurance solutions for their valuable artworks. They act as intermediaries between the art owner and insurance companies, helping them navigate the complexities of art insurance policies and find the best coverage for their specific needs. courtiers assurance d’œuvre d’art have a deep understanding of the art market and the unique risks associated with owning and displaying artworks, making them invaluable partners in safeguarding these precious pieces.

One of the key responsibilities of art insurance brokers is to assess the value of artworks and determine the appropriate coverage needed to protect them. Artworks can vary greatly in value, from priceless masterpieces by renowned artists to contemporary pieces by emerging talents. courtiers assurance d’œuvre d’art work closely with appraisers and other experts to accurately appraise the value of artworks and ensure that they are adequately insured against potential risks.

In addition to assessing the value of artworks, art insurance brokers also help art owners understand the specific risks that their pieces are exposed to. Whether it’s the threat of theft, damage during transportation, or deterioration due to environmental factors, courtiers assurance d’œuvre d’art have the knowledge and expertise to identify and mitigate these risks. By working with art insurance brokers, art owners can rest assured that their valuable pieces are protected and that they have the right insurance coverage in place.

courtiers assurance d’œuvre d’art also play a crucial role in the event of a loss or damage to an artwork. In the unfortunate event that an artwork is stolen, damaged, or destroyed, art insurance brokers work with the art owner and insurance companies to facilitate the claims process and ensure that the owner receives fair compensation for their loss. This can involve coordinating with appraisers, restoration experts, and other professionals to assess the extent of the damage and determine the appropriate course of action to repair or replace the artwork.

Furthermore, art insurance brokers also provide valuable advice and guidance to art owners on how to best protect their artworks and minimize the risk of loss or damage. This can include recommendations on security measures, conservation techniques, and proper storage and display of artworks. By drawing on their expertise and experience, courtiers assurance d’œuvre d’art help art owners make informed decisions about how to safeguard their valuable collections for future generations.
